DRUG ALERT

CLASS 3 MEDICINES RECALL
Action within 5 days
PHARMACY LEVEL RECALL
12 July 2010 EL (10)A/17 Our ref:  MDR 59-01/10

Dear Healthcare Professional,

Teva UK Limited and Generics (UK) Limited

Glibenclamide 5 mg Tablets in Teva UK Limited and Generics (UK) Limited Livery

PL 00289/0048

Product in Teva UK Limited Livery

  Batch Number  Expiry Date  Pack Size  First Distributed
  000537  September 2012  1x28  18 Nov 2009
  001315  September 2012  1x28  11 Mar 2010

Product in Generics (UK) Limited Livery

  Batch Number  Expiry Date  Pack Size  First Distributed
  000681 September 2012  1x28 23 Nov 2009


Further to the Drug Alert issued by the MHRA on 15 March 2010 (EL (10)A/06 Rev 1) concerning the recall of some batches of this product due to issues with tablet dissolution during routine stability testing, Teva UK Limited has informed us that it has now received new stock. The three batches which remained on the market at the time in order to avoid market shortages are now being recalled by the company, see details in the tables above.

Remaining stocks of these batches should be returned to the original wholesaler for credit. For further stock enquiries please contact Teva UK Customer Liaison Team on 0800 590502.
